Protac backrest
Anyone have one of these? I have an "old man" back and am starting to look for a backrest for my 03' 883. Searching Google only brings up this brand of rest and it is available from only one source. A bit on the pricey side also. I have the ability to manufacture one (I have made several) but see no real good spot to attach one. I am using a stock 2 up seat. Any help or suggestions would be appreciated.
